Lauda and Hunt set to be team-mate's in Nascar

After their father's immense rivalry in motorsports, it is Freddie Hunt and Mathias Lauda who are set to make the DF1 line-up in Euro Nascar series. It's official! I'm so pleased to announce I'll be racing for DF1 alongside Mathias Lauda in Euro NASCAR next year! pic.twitter.com/vKmOhNANOF — Freddie Hunt (@freddiehunt76) October 3, 2015
